Shern Miller Obituary

Shern L. Miller was born on November 5, 1969, in Brooksville, MS to Willie L. Miller and Amelia A. Miller. At an early age, Shern accepted Jesus Christ as his Savior and became a baptized believer and member of Brownridge M.B. Church of Crawford, MS under the pastorageof the late Reverend J.H. Cockrell.

During his years of education, he was a proud 1987 graduate of Motley/West Lowndes High School of Columbus, MS. At the age of 17, Shern enlisted in the United States Army. He valued this service highly and during his service he obtained a bachelor's degree in business administration from Devry University. As part of his service, he served in Operation Desert Shield/ Desert Storm and Operation Iraqi Freedom. While serving he received the following medals: Army Commendation Medal, Army Achievement Medal, South West Asia Service Medal, South West Asia Service Medal with Bronze Star, Global War on Terrorism Service Medal, and Iraq Campaign Medal with Campaign Star. After serving his 27 years in the United States Army, he then retired in January 2014 with the rank of Sergeant.
